Riverside County Department of Waste Resources has an opportunity for an Equipment Operator II located at the Badlands Landfill, located in Moreno Valley, or Lamb Canyon Landfill, located in Beaumont.

Possession of a valid California Commercial Driver License: Class B i s required when applying for this position. A DMV Driving Report (generated within the last 30 days) must be attached to your application to advance to an interview.

This position involves the operation of heavy construction equipment. The incumbent will undertake various maintenance and construction tasks, with the opportunity to work independently or take a lead role overseeing crews.

The responsibilities of the Equipment Operator II will include operation heavy construction equipment such as Bulldozers, Compactors, Scrapers, Motor Graders and Excavators in support of landfill site operations. The i ncumbent in this position will use machinery to push, compact and cover municipal solid waste in close proximity to the public. Additional duties may include occasional operation of light equipment including a water truck for dust control, loaders, backhoes, etc. for road maintenance/grading work; and to do other work as required.

Competitive candidates will possess experience in the maintenance or construction of landfill facilities, including the operation of Bulldozers, Loaders, Scrapers, Motor Graders and Excavators in support of landfill site operations. And, knowledge of their required safety procedures and operational rules.

Schedule

4/10, from 5:30 a.m. to 3:30 p.m., with at least one Saturday worked per month (subject to change based on department needs). The incumbent will receive differential pay for Saturday shifts. This position offers a dynamic work schedule with the added benefit of additional compensation for weekend hours.

Examples Of Essential Duties

  • Operate tracked and/or wheeled motorized construction equipment (e.g., loaders, excavators, motor graders, scrapers, refuse compactors, oil mixers, and dozers) within required tolerance in the maintenance and construction of roads, landfills, flood control channels, and other public work facilities.
  • Prepare, grade, and shape new county roads, landfills, and flood control channels; check and set grades.
  • Work from survey reference marks, plans, and specifications; clear roads, channels and other facilities of storm debris and damage; construct and repair storm drains, culverts, catch basins, and concrete gutters.
  • Service and maintain assigned equipment; may operate low-bed or trucks with trailers in hauling equipment or materials.
  • Use a variety of hand and power tools in performing work.

Minimum Qualifications

Experience: Two years in the maintenance or construction of public work facilities (e.g., roads, airports, landfills, or flood control channels) which included one year operating tracked and/or wheeled motorized construction equipment as a primary duty.

N ote: Incumbents will be manually tested on heavy equipment operation during the interview.

License: Possession of a valid California Commercial Driver's License Class B at the time of application.Must have the availability to obtain a valid California Commercial Driver's License Class A and a Tanker endorsement withing 4 months from hire date. A DMV Driving Report (generated within the last 30 days) must be attached to your application to advance to an interview.

This position has been designated by the Department of Transportation (DOT) as safety-sensitive, applicants are required to complete a DOT mandated alcohol and drug-screening. (A positive test or refusal to test during the past two years will disqualify an applicant from consideration for County employment). Reference checks from former DOT regulated employers are also required. Applicants must submit a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) driving record prior to hire.

Employees in safety-sensitive positions are subject to DOT alcohol/drug testing in the following situations: random, reasonable suspicion/cause, return-to-duty, and post-accident.

Visit DOT Requirements for details.

Physical Requirements: The Equipment Operator II primarily operates outdoors at landfill sites and is exposed to inclement weather, odors/fumes, insects/rodents, and other environmental conditions. Incumbents will only have access to a portable restroom and outdoor hand-washing facility at the landfill site. The responsibilities require independent mobility to stand, climb, reach, and move heavy materials such as bags or mechanical parts.

Knowledge of: The tools, materials, and equipment commonly used in public works construction and maintenance; the operation and maintenance of gasoline and diesel-powered construction and maintenance equipment.

Ability to: Perform a variety of skilled maintenance and construction tasks, including working to grade; safely operate tracked and/or wheeled motorized equipment; read plans and specifications relating to construction and field maintenance work; follow oral and written directions.
